Land of Oz

1 Star2 Stars3 Stars4 Stars5 Stars

Land of Oz was an enchanting park picked right out of the movie The Wizard of Oz. Opened in 1970 in North Carolina, it was a true reflection of the movie with a yellow brick road, the dazzling Emerald City, costumes from the original movie, and so much more! After a series of disasters including the death of the visionary owner, fire and theft, the park closed in 1980. The current owners of the property do open the park back up every so often for an autumn festival and tours, so if you’d like to visit during one of these rare occasions, check out

    Leave a Reply

    Your email address will not be published. Required fields are marked *